How sensor hubs on smartphones helped bring artificial intelligence to the edge
AIoT, TinyML, EdgeAI and MLSensors are the latest buzz words in the Artificial Intelligence and Embedded Systems communities. There’s plenty of hype around designing highly optimised, low footprint machine learning algorithms that run on ultra low power microcontrollers and DSPs targeted at sensing applications including but not limited to audio and video.
